        <title>31ab09b4 - drivers: Add hardware timestamp engine (HTE) subsystem</title>
        <link>http://172.16.0.5:8080/history/linux-6.15/drivers/hte/Makefile#31ab09b4</link>
        <description>drivers: Add hardware timestamp engine (HTE) subsystemSome devices can timestamp system lines/signals/Buses in real-timeusing the hardware counter or other hardware means which can givefiner granularity and help avoid jitter introduced by softwaretimestamping. To utilize such functionality, this patchset createsHTE subsystem where devices can register themselves as providers sothat the consumers devices can request specific line from theproviders. The patch also adds compilation support in Makefile andmenu options in Kconfig.The provider does following:- Registers chip with the framework.- Provides translation hook to convert logical line id.- Provides enable/disable, request/release callbacks.- Pushes timestamp data to HTE subsystem.The consumer does following:- Initializes line attribute.- Gets HTE timestamp descriptor.- Requests timestamp functionality.- Puts HTE timestamp descriptor.Signed-off-by: Dipen Patel &lt;dipenp@nvidia.com&gt;Reported-by: kernel test robot &lt;lkp@intel.com&gt;Signed-off-by: Thierry Reding &lt;treding@nvidia.com&gt;
